Hi Chris the engine serial No would indicate that it is an OM 662 which I believe was the series built under licence,,,,,
Hi Chris research (see Email)reveals that only the OM662 and OM 662LA were fitted with a turbo (STT) the LA was also intercooled....perhaps this was one of the MB deals whereby the shipped all the parts and the Koreans did the assembly.might not be as bad as you think..the Musso forums seem to be focussed on whacked gearboxes rather than engines...electrics might be the same as the early sprinter virtually none... so it might work !!!
